Bart, enjoy your work! Keep it up. I have a question about the criterion of dissimilarity. Here’s the disconnect we have. You say (and I agree) that early Christians were willing to change stories about Jesus — and even make up new stories. That being the case, wouldn’t they change any dissimilar quote from Jesus to make it not be dissimilar.
